On a four-sided backgammon table, two teams face each other; one team moves clockwise, the other counterclockwise. Otherwise, the rules follow standard backgammon pretty closely. A variant is supplied allowing four *individual* players.
A newer version from 2005, Quadrogammon, features a silk-screened roll-up board.
